1. Mobile-First Shopping
More people shop using phones than computers now. That’s why mobile-first design is no longer a choice—it’s a must.
Stores are focusing on faster load times, cleaner layouts, and easier checkouts for mobile users. Mobile wallets like Apple Pay and Google Pay also make paying faster and safer.
Why it matters: If your store isn’t mobile-friendly, you could be losing customers.
2. AI and Personalization
Artificial Intelligence (AI) is making online shopping feel more personal. AI tools recommend products, predict what customers might buy next, and power smart chatbots.
When a shopper feels understood, they’re more likely to buy. Expect more stores to use AI for smarter, more customized shopping experiences.
Example: A customer who buys baby clothes might later get suggestions for toys or kids’ books.
3. Social Commerce Is Growing
People now shop directly through social media apps like Instagram, Facebook, and TikTok. This is called social commerce.
Shoppers see a product in a post or video, tap it, and buy it—without leaving the app. Influencers and brand pages play a big role in this trend.
Tip: Businesses should invest in social content and connect their shops to platforms where their audience spends time.
4. Sustainability in Shopping
More customers care about eco-friendly products and ethical brands. They want to know how things are made, where they come from, and how they’re packaged.
Stores that offer sustainable choices—like recycled packaging or carbon-neutral delivery—are getting more attention.
Note: Clear messaging around your eco efforts builds trust and loyalty.
5. Voice Search on the Rise
With smart speakers and voice assistants growing, more people are using voice to search for products. Phrases like “find red shoes near me” or “order dog food online” are common.
Optimizing your store for voice search—using natural keywords and clear product names—can help you reach these shoppers.
6. Faster and Flexible Delivery Options
Customers expect quick shipping. Same-day or next-day delivery is becoming standard. Stores are also offering flexible options like:
-
Pick up in-store
-
Drop-off lockers
-
Real-time tracking
Good delivery service can turn a first-time buyer into a repeat customer.
7. Augmented Reality (AR) Shopping
AR tools let customers “try before they buy.” Whether it’s placing furniture in a room or seeing how glasses look on your face, AR builds confidence before checkout.
This trend is growing, especially in fashion, beauty, and home décor stores.
